【发布时间】:2015-12-21 03:23:42
【问题描述】:
在我看来,您可以输入任何随机的用户名/密码组合,并且插入式 UI 小部件和后端都会接受它作为有效的 PayPal 帐户。付款将通过一切。
有没有办法可以将 Braintree 沙盒设置为只接受真实的 PayPal 账户?
【问题讨论】:
标签: paypal e-commerce braintree
在我看来,您可以输入任何随机的用户名/密码组合,并且插入式 UI 小部件和后端都会接受它作为有效的 PayPal 帐户。付款将通过一切。
有没有办法可以将 Braintree 沙盒设置为只接受真实的 PayPal 账户?
【问题讨论】:
标签: paypal e-commerce braintree
全面披露:我在 Braintree 工作。如果您还有任何问题,请随时联系support。
Braintree 沙盒允许您将任何您喜欢的电子邮件地址和密码传递到 PayPal 对话框 as mentioned in Braintree's documentation。您可以使用fake PayPal nonces found on the Testing and Go-Live page 进行测试,但请记住,Braintree didn't actually design the PayPal sandbox for handling end-to-end tests。在沙盒中进行的所有 PayPal 交易都使用相同的假 PayPal 帐户。因此,无法将您的 Sandbox 帐户配置为接受真实的 PayPal 帐户。我们建议您在上线时perform a few low-value sale transactions with each of the payment methods you plan to accept,包括 PayPal。
您可以测试 PayPal 帐户中的信息错误的案例,就像测试一张坏信用卡一样:使用我们的测试和上线页面中的一个虚假无效随机数。如果您的代码正确处理这些情况,您可以确信它也能够处理包含错误信息的 PayPal 帐户。
【讨论】: